IP查询
查询
你查询的IP:[119.78.253.5] 地理位置:中国科技网
最新查询
120.30.164.3
219.244.6.26
121.60.224.1
119.80.7.120
121.66.16.30
221.12.38.76
119.44.187.3
116.95.93.69
124.64.17.126
119.78.253.5
61.236.144.220
117.60.197.246
119.41.58.129
203.99.80.143
59.192.112.201
124.108.40.137
114.60.17.127
203.191.16.131
220.112.116.21
220.252.216.43
119.48.234.33
203.128.32.96
58.128.110.169
61.232.159.65
203.81.16.166
117.76.30.123
119.112.62.250
202.136.224.100
203.158.16.135
202.63.248.205
118.248.15.221